The 2011 movie Fast Five, which was directed by Justin Lin, is in the latest "Legacy Trailer" for the Fast & Furious movies. It is especially notable because it brings Luke Hobbs, played by Dwayne Johnson, into the mix. In the story, Vin Diesel and the rest of the group go to Rio to pull off a $100 million heist. Gisele Yashar, played by Gal Gadot, was also introduced in the movie.

Louis Leterrier is directing Fast X. He took over from Justin Lin, who left the project suddenly because they had different ideas about how to make the movie. Lin and Dan Mazeau wrote the script for the movie, and Lin is still involved as a producer.

Diesel, Tyrese Gibson, Michelle Rodriguez, Jordana Brewster, Ludacris, Nathalie Emmanuel, Sung Kang, and Scott Eastwood will all play the same roles in the movie. In the tenth movie, Jason Momoa (Aquaman), Daniela Melchior (The Suicide Squad), Brie Larson (Captain Marvel), and Alan Ritchson (Reacher) will join the cast for the first time. Momoa is expected to play the bad guy.
